Position Overview

We are in search of a meticulous and proficient Per Diem Staff Pharmacist to enhance our pharmacy operations. The successful candidate will be tasked with the precise dispensing of medications, offering clinical assistance to healthcare teams, and ensuring adherence to regulatory standards. This role will involve working during overnight shifts, thereby supporting the seamless delivery of pharmacy services and upholding exceptional patient care standards.

Key Responsibilities:
  1. Medication Dispensing: Ensure accurate dispensing of medications as per prescription directives, prioritizing patient safety and compliance with legal regulations.
  2. Clinical Collaboration: Work alongside healthcare professionals to provide clinical insights, including drug information, therapeutic recommendations, and monitoring for adverse reactions.
  3. Order Assessment: Scrutinize and confirm medication orders for accuracy, suitability, and compliance with formulary protocols.
  4. Quality Control: Engage in regular quality control measures to uphold high standards of pharmacy services and regulatory compliance.
  5. Patient Counseling: Educate patients on medication usage, potential side effects, and address any related questions to ensure proper understanding and adherence.
  6. Emergency Preparedness: Participate actively in emergency response initiatives, providing timely and accurate medication support during critical scenarios.
  7. Inventory Oversight: Supervise and manage pharmacy inventory, ensuring sufficient stock levels and minimizing waste.
  8. Team Collaboration: Collaborate with other healthcare professionals to enhance patient outcomes and ensure a comprehensive approach to care.
  9. Record Keeping: Maintain precise and current patient records, prescription files, and necessary documentation.
  10. Ongoing Education: Stay updated on new medications, treatment protocols, and industry advancements through continuous education and training.

Compensation: Salary is based on education and experience, with a range from $47.50 to $68.00 per hour. Eligible for shift and PRN differentials.

Minimum Qualifications:
  • PharmD degree from an accredited pharmacy institution.
Experience:
  • Prior experience in a hospital or clinical pharmacy environment is preferred.
Licensure:
  • Must be licensed to practice pharmacy in the State of North Carolina.
Skills and Abilities:
  • Strong pharmaceutical knowledge and skills.
  • Accountability for patient outcomes.
  • Prioritization of patient needs.
  • Integrity in pharmacy practice.
  • Ability to accept and respond to constructive feedback.
  • Proficiency in relevant computer applications.
  • Effective interpersonal skills.
  • Judgment in high-pressure situations.
  • Adaptability to changing duties and workload.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Empathetic listening skills.
  • Organizational skills for detail management.
  • Capability to manage medium to large-scale projects with multiple reviews.
Physical Requirements:
  • Ability to lift, position, push, pull, and/or transfer weights exceeding 50 pounds.
  • Manual dexterity and mobility.
  • Prolonged periods of sitting, standing, or walking.
  • Physical agility including bending, squatting, twisting, and turning.
  • Near vision acuity for tasks requiring close visual attention.
